The rusty sparrow (Aimophila rufescens) is a species of bird in the Emberizidae family that is found in Belize, Costa Rica, El Salvador, Guatemala, Honduras, Mexico, and Nicaragua. Its natural habitats are subtropical or tropical dry forests, subtropical or tropical moist montane forests, and subtropical or tropical high-altitude shrubland.
